#cd0198 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cd0198 is composed of 80.4% red, 0.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 99.5% magenta, 25.9%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 315.6 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 40.4%. #cd0198 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ff02ff with #9b0031. Closest websafe color is: #cc0099.

Shades and Tints of #cd0198

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0007 is the darkest color, while #fff5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#cd0198

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e606a is the less saturated color, while #cd0198 is the most saturated one.
